Transaction 8745967854104508dd74b3705a23508e4d759d5f2c1a12e4d1809e332eb080fe
1 Input
1 Output
-
8745967854104508dd74b3705a23508e4d759d5f2c1a12e4d1809e332eb080fe:0
- value
- 11318188
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e594e18a9d9868403544f65e682b4d38bacb130 OP_EQUAL
- address
- 3EfgroqLjwcG4javxT8yQMGbDcohKNr72X